💡 Breaking Down "Mingrui": A Fusion of Light and Intelligence
Let’s start with the basics: what exactly does "mingrui" mean? In Chinese philosophy, "ming" (明) represents brightness or clarity, while "rui" (锐) signifies sharpness or keen insight. Together, they create a powerful concept that describes someone who possesses both clear vision and razor-sharp intellect. 🌟
